Maybe change it form "buufer" to "cache" :whistle: ,

The "buffer" is normally intended as "hardware", as in:

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Disk_buffer

Looky here ;):

http://www.uwe-sieber.de/ntcacheset_e.html

I tested the programs and I don't see how to set the cache min/max values for every drive.

NtCacheSetter sets min and max value but not for each drive.

Anyway I tried some values but I didn't see a change in what Task Manager reports.

SetSystemFileCacheSize is not for Windows XP.

FileCacheTest is for testing.
